当前位置: 首页 > news >正文

‌2026趋势预测:AI将如何改变软件测试岗位?

AI浪潮下的测试新纪元

随着人工智能技术的飞速发展,软件测试领域正经历前所未有的转型。截至2026年,AI已从辅助工具演变为测试生态的核心驱动力,预计将重塑测试流程、工具链及从业者角色。本文基于当前技术轨迹(如机器学习、自然语言处理),预测未来两年AI对测试岗位的具体影响。我们将聚焦自动化测试升级、智能分析应用、技能需求演变等维度,旨在为测试工程师提供可操作的洞察。全球测试团队若忽视此趋势,可能面临效率滞后与竞争力下滑的风险;反之,主动拥抱AI者将解锁更高精度与创新潜力。

一、AI驱动的自动化测试:从脚本执行到智能决策
  1. 自动化工具的质变‌:传统工具(如Selenium)正被AI增强型平台取代。2026年,主流测试框架(如Testim、Tricentis)将集成生成式AI模型,实现“自愈测试”。例如,AI可动态修复因UI变更而失败的脚本,减少30%以上维护时间。预测性算法还能优化测试覆盖率:通过分析历史缺陷数据,AI自动识别高风险模块,优先执行关键用例。这将把测试效率提升40%,但要求测试人员从“编码者”转向“策略师”,专注于定义测试目标和边界条件。
  2. 智能测试用例生成‌:AI模型(如基于GPT-4的衍生工具)将自动化生成测试场景。输入需求文档后,AI解析用户故事,生成覆盖所有路径的用例集,减少人为遗漏。在金融软件测试中,此类工具已模拟出99%的边缘案例,缩短50%的测试设计周期。挑战在于:AI可能过度生成冗余用例,需测试员介入审核与优先级排序,强化其业务理解能力。
二、预测性分析与质量保障:缺陷预防优于修复
  1. 缺陷预测与风险防控‌:AI模型利用历史项目数据(如代码提交、缺陷日志),构建预测性分析引擎。2026年,工具如Applitools将实时监控开发周期,在编码阶段预警潜在缺陷(准确率达85%),实现“左移测试”。例如,AI分析代码复杂度与团队经验,预测高风险文件,引导测试资源前置投入。这减少了后期返工成本,但需测试员精通数据解读,将AI输出转化为可行动项。
  2. 非功能测试的智能化‌:性能与安全测试受益显著。AI驱动负载测试工具(如LoadRunner Cloud)模拟百万级用户行为,识别性能瓶颈;安全测试中,AI扫描代码库,预测漏洞(如OWASP Top 10),较传统方法快70%。在DevOps流水线中,AI实时优化测试套件,确保持续交付质量。测试人员角色随之演变:从手动执行转向配置AI规则与验证结果。
三、测试岗位的重塑:从执行者到AI协作者
  1. 角色转型‌:2026年,初级测试任务(如重复性验证)将全面自动化,岗位需求向高阶技能倾斜。测试工程师需成为“AI监督者”:训练模型、调优算法、确保伦理合规(如避免AI偏见)。例如,在电商应用测试中,测试员设计AI公平性检查点,防止推荐系统歧视。同时,“测试策略师”角色崛起,负责整合AI工具链,制定质量度量标准。
  2. 技能升级需求‌:核心能力从手工测试转向:
    • 技术栈‌:掌握Python/R用于AI模型调试,了解MLOps工具(如MLflow)。
    • 业务融合‌:深化领域知识(如金融、医疗),指导AI生成业务相关测试。
    • 软技能‌:加强批判性思维,以验证AI输出;协作能力,联动开发与数据团队。
      调研显示,2026年60%的测试岗位将要求AI技能认证,企业培训投入增长200%。
四、挑战与机遇:平衡自动化与人文价值
  1. 潜在风险‌:AI可能引发就业焦虑——预估15%的初级岗位被自动化取代,但中高阶需求增长30%。伦理挑战突出:如AI测试决策的“黑箱”问题,需测试员建立透明性审计流程。此外,过度依赖AI可能导致技能退化,团队需坚持“人机协同”原则。
  2. 战略机遇‌:AI释放测试员创造力,转向探索性测试与用户体验优化。例如,AI生成虚拟用户反馈,测试员分析情感倾向,提升产品粘性。企业可构建“AI测试中心”,集中资源创新;个人应拥抱终身学习,2026年热门路径包括AI测试认证(如ISTQB AI扩展)与跨职能转型。
结论:拥抱变革,定义未来

至2026年,AI将软件测试从“质量检查”升级为“智能保障引擎”,核心价值转向风险预测与业务赋能。测试从业者需主动进化:掌握AI工具、强化策略思维、坚守伦理底线。这不仅是技术迭代,更是职业重生——那些驾驭AI的测试员,将成为数字化时代的质量守护者。未来已来,唯变不变。

精选文章

意识模型的测试可能性:从理论到实践的软件测试新范式

构建软件测试中的伦理风险识别与评估体系

http://www.jsqmd.com/news/262201/

相关文章:

  • java-SSM350的图书馆图书借阅管理系统x1x74-springboot
  • 如果AI测试工具会吐槽开发者:一个“智能”视角的血泪控诉
  • Sambert推理日志查看:错误排查与性能监控方法
  • java-SSM351的药品商超销售进销存管理系统vue-springboot
  • 从SLAM到Spatial AI,传统SLAMer该何去何从?
  • 当AI遇见DevOps:加速部署的隐藏技巧
  • GPT-OSS开源模型部署教程:WEBUI一键推理操作手册
  • java-SSM352的校园餐厅美食分享系统多商家-springboot
  • IEEE T-RO重磅 | 复杂三维环境的建图与理解,RAZER:零样本开放词汇3D重建的时空聚合框架
  • 自动对焦的原理:相机与镜头如何实现精准对焦
  • 具身智能与数字化展示:开启未来交互新纪元 - 指南
  • 测试人员的AI焦虑?数据告诉你职业前景光明
  • 2026-01-17-牛客刷题笔记-有趣的区间
  • ‌AI伦理在软件开发中的雷区:如何避免灾难性bug‌
  • GESP认证C++编程真题解析 | 202406 八级
  • RPC分布式通信(3)--RPC基础框架接口
  • 2026-01-17-LeetCode刷题笔记-3047-求交集区域内的最大正方形面积
  • 2025年广州市“人工智能+“典型案例集
  • 实用指南:零基础学AI大模型之Milvus DML实战
  • DeepSeek V4架构深度解析:梁文锋团队开辟的「存算分离」新范式
  • 2026年量子计算:算力革命与安全新范式报告
  • 互联网大厂Java求职面试实战:从微服务到AI集成的全栈技术问答
  • Fun-ASR-MLT-Nano-2512语音餐饮:点餐语音识别系统
  • 详细介绍:Apache Flink SQL 入门与常见问题解析
  • Qwen2.5-7B-Instruct部署教程:智能数据分析流水线
  • 基于Java ssm家庭财务管理系统(源码+文档+运行视频+讲解视频)
  • PyTorch-2.x降本增效实战:纯净系统+阿里源部署省时50%
  • 基于Java springboot医院低值耗材管理系统耗材出入库(源码+文档+运行视频+讲解视频)
  • 零基础理解TC3xx中AUTOSAR OS的保护机制核心要点
  • YOLOv9教育科研应用:高校计算机视觉课程实验设计